About the role:

Southern, West and Central Africa (SWC) covers more than 14 countries across Southern, Central and West Africa. It has statutory presence in 7 countries including two listed companies (Ghana and Seychelles) and one JV (Angola) and oversees manufacturing in four countries. It also manages partnerships to manufacture and distribute the Diageo portfolio across around 35 countries in Sub Saharan Africa. It manages a full TBA portfolio: beer, RTD's (Ready-To-Drinks), local spirits, international spirits and top end luxury spirits.

The countries' economies vary significantly and present different levels of opportunity and challenge for business growth as well as language diversity. There is a high level of volatility across the countries and fierce competition within the beer and spirits portfolio given Africa has the largest vibrant and growing LPA -34 consumer base.

In Diageo Africa context, the margin profile is attractive, with a higher focus on spirits and outsourcing of beer manufacturing. Our extensive and exciting brand portfolio serves consumers across diverse demographics and delivers against consumers' in-culture premiumisation experiences.Our extensive and exciting brand portfolio serves consumers across diverse demographics and occasions and deliversagainst consumers' in-culture premiumisation experiences. It is also well positioned to tap into future trends.

Distributor and creative partnerships are critical for driving growth for this remit as well as strategic choices to be made on portfolio, production, logistics and route to market.

Given its scale and margin profile, SWC is critical for the success of Diageo in Africa; there is also significant scope of business expansion - new territories, new categories and new routes to market.
